







A Dyersville man was electrocuted Friday morning while trying to reconnect his home’s electric service.
The Delaware County Sheriff’s office said that Jamie John Pottebaum, 38, was using an aluminum pole in an attempt to reach the top disconnect of his system when the pole made contact with a 7,200-volt power line, sending the electricity through his body.
The utility company told the sheriff’s office that it had cut electricity to Pottebaum’s home on April 21.
